Across TCGA cell cohorts, AGAP2 mutation is significantly associated with the RNA expression of many other genes, with 1,070 significant associations in total. LARGE_INTESTINE shows the largest number of these associations.

The most reproducible AGAP2-associated genes across cancer lineages are MEI4, IL4, and OR10J1. Each is linked with AGAP2 in more than 1 cancer types. Because this analysis shows association rather than direction, both AGAP2-to-partner and partner-to-AGAP2 results are reported.
